The National Weather Service said Saturday it was indeed a tornado that struck a Belvidere theater where a roof collapsed and killed a 50-year-old man during a rock concert Friday night. The man’s sister said he was a car and heavy metal enthusiast who attended the concert with his son — who saw the roof collapse on his father.
